Being able to monitor the wildlife in your garden, and taking small, simple steps that allow us to measure our successes in attracting certain species, boosting species numbers, and, most crucially, increasing the number of beneficial interactions within the system can make a big difference. 

Collecting data and monitoring the life around us can boost our confidence as gardeners, helping us to see empirically that we are on the right track. It can help us see where we are doing really well, and also where there may still be improvements to be made.
